i965: Add some plumbing for gathering OA results.
Currently, this only considers the monitor start and end snapshots. This is woefully insufficient, but allows me to add a bunch of the infrastructure now and flesh it out later. Signed-off-by: Kenneth Graunke <kenneth@whitecape.org> Reviewed-by: Eric Anholt <eric@anholt.net>
